PROGRAM SPECIALIST
Air Force Materiel Command
Hill AFB, Utah$41k – $97k4d ago
About the role
Develops plans, schedules, and trains all employees. Plans, organizes, and oversees the activities of the organization, ensuring that manpower, personnel, force development/education and training related operations comply with legal and regulatory requirements and meet customer needs. Participates in special manpower, personnel, force development/education and training related operation projects and initiatives and performs special assignments. Represents the organization with a variety of installation and functional area organizations. Establishes, develops, and maintains effective working relationships. Establishes review systems for the organization that make certain government needs are met and validated, and that economy and quality of operations are maintained or improved.
